In the world of international trade, various methods are used to ensure that transactions are secure and beneficial for both parties involved. One such method is known as documents against payment, which plays a crucial role in facilitating trade between buyers and sellers across borders. This term refers to a specific arrangement where the seller provides shipping documents to a bank, which then releases these documents to the buyer only upon receipt of payment. Essentially, this method acts as a safeguard for sellers, ensuring that they receive their due payment before relinquishing control over the goods. To understand the significance of documents against payment, it is important to consider the risks involved in international trade. Sellers often face the challenge of shipping goods to buyers who may be located thousands of miles away, making it difficult to verify the buyer's credibility and ability to pay. By utilizing documents against payment, sellers can mitigate this risk, as they retain ownership of the goods until payment is completed. This process typically involves the seller shipping the goods and then submitting the necessary documentation, such as the bill of lading and invoice, to their bank. The bank then forwards these documents to the buyer's bank, which will only release them to the buyer once payment has been made. This system not only protects sellers but also provides a level of assurance to buyers. Buyers can be confident that they will receive the goods they have paid for, as the seller cannot access the payment without providing the required documentation. Furthermore, documents against payment can help build trust between trading partners, as both parties are aware of the terms of the transaction and the conditions under which the goods will be released. However, it is essential to note that while documents against payment offers several advantages, it is not without its limitations. For instance, this method does not provide the same level of security as a letter of credit, where payment is guaranteed by the bank. In some cases, buyers may be hesitant to use documents against payment if they feel uncertain about the quality or legitimacy of the goods being shipped. Therefore, it is crucial for sellers to establish a good reputation and maintain open lines of communication with their buyers to alleviate any concerns. In conclusion, documents against payment serves as an effective tool in international trade, allowing sellers to protect their interests while providing buyers with confidence in their purchases. By understanding the mechanics of this arrangement, both parties can engage in smoother transactions and foster long-term business relationships. As global trade continues to evolve, the importance of secure payment methods like documents against payment will remain a vital aspect of successful commerce.
